Ghost’s recent live performance of “Lachryma” on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on showcased the band’s signature blend of occult rock and theatrical performance. The evening, held on July 23, was a glimpse into the captivating world of Ghost’s musical artistry as they took the stage at Studio 6B in Rockefeller Center, New York. Despite potential backlash from some critics, Ghost remained unbothered and full of energy throughout their performance.

The featured track, “Lachryma,” is from Ghost’s latest album, Skeletá, which marked a milestone for the band by debuting at number one on the US Billboard 200 chart. The album’s success was further highlighted by its impressive sales figures, with 86,000 album-equivalent units sold in the first week, 77,000 of which were traditional sales, showing sustained popularity for the band. Interestingly, a significant portion of these sales, around 44,000 units, came from vinyl sales, setting a new record for hard rock albums in the modern era. This remarkable achievement solidified Skeletá’s position as one of the best-performing rock albums in recent times.
